Output 64cf94de891181bffde0ed33817776af68b3bd5a68a3d0f01cf6967dd4268043:0

value
1937057
script pubkey
OP_0 OP_PUSHBYTES_20 fac7c5460d2a7222760e197677aad45e61b988c7
address
bc1qltru23sd9fezyaswr9m802k5tesmnzx8n7psve
transaction
64cf94de891181bffde0ed33817776af68b3bd5a68a3d0f01cf6967dd4268043
confirmations
228443
spent
true